The CW has released the first official images from the upcoming midseason finale of The Flash, and there are some very interesting reveals in them. By far the biggest is our first look at Keiynan Lonsdale as Wally West. In this continuity, he’s Iris West’s brother and Joe’s long lost son, and unlike his comic book counterpart, he appears to be roughly the same age as Barry Allen.

It remains to be seen whether or not he’ll ultimately suit up as a Speedster of course, but if it does happen, it likely won’t be for another season or two.

Another very cool shot here is Mark Hamill’s (Star Wars: The Force Awakens) return as The Trickster. Seeing as he’s joined by Captain Cold and The Weather Wizard, chances are that this episode is going to see The Rogues assemble for the very first time. That’s something which is long overdue in this series, and laying the groundwork for them to become the big bad of season three would definitely be smart.

Here’s the official synopsis for this episode of The Flash, shedding more light on what we should expect:

When Mark Mardon AKA The Weather Wizard (guest star Liam McIntyre) returns to break Leonard Snart AKA Captain Cold (guest star Wentworth Miller) and James Jesse AKA The Trickster (guest star Mark Hamill) out of Iron Heights, Barry (Grant Gustin) must stop these rogues from taking over Central City during Christmas. Meanwhile, Joe (Jesse L. Martin) and Iris (Candice Patton) meet Wally West (Keiynan Lonsdale).

Season two of The Flash has been very impressive so far, and this looks set to be one of the most fan pleasing instalments yet. With no sign or mention of Zoom though, hopefully the show won’t neglect that overarching plot too much.
